What these times mean
Solar times in Palanca shift throughout the year. Each stage of the day brings distinct light that photographers, outdoor planners, and everyday users rely on.
- Dawn
- The first usable twilight before sunrise, when the horizon brightens and color gradually returns to the sky.
- Sunrise
- The moment the upper edge of the sun appears above the horizon, starting direct daylight.
- Golden Hour
- The low-angle window just after sunrise and just before sunset, producing warm, soft light favored by photographers.
- Sunset
- The moment the upper edge of the sun drops below the horizon, ending direct sunlight for the day.
- Dusk
- The fading twilight after sunset, ending with astronomical dusk when the sky becomes fully dark.
Monthly daylight in Palanca
Sunrise, sunset, and total daylight in Palanca on the 15th of each month for 2026. Times reflect the city's local timezone.
| Month |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 5:47 AM | 6:43 PM | 12h 55m |
| February | 6:02 AM | 6:37 PM | 12h 35m |
| March | 6:09 AM | 6:20 PM | 12h 11m |
| April | 6:13 AM | 5:58 PM | 11h 45m |
| May | 6:19 AM | 5:45 PM | 11h 25m |
| June | 6:29 AM | 5:43 PM | 11h 14m |
| July | 6:32 AM | 5:51 PM | 11h 19m |
| August | 6:22 AM | 5:58 PM | 11h 36m |
| September | 6:01 AM | 6:01 PM | 12h 00m |
| October | 5:39 AM | 6:04 PM | 12h 26m |
| November | 5:26 AM | 6:15 PM | 12h 49m |
| December | 5:30 AM | 6:31 PM | 13h 01m |
